UNH Signs Agreement With University in China
November 26, 2008

Tom Brady, dean of the College of Life Sciences and Agriculture, shakes hands after signing an agreement with Zhejiang Ocean University in China. Pingguo He, UNH research associate professor, stands behind Brady (silver tie).
A Memorandum of Understanding has been signed between UNH and Zhejiang Ocean University (ZOU) in Zhejiang, China, to foster and promote academic and cultural exchanges between the two universities.
Initially the interest is in ocean-related subjects but the program may expand into other areas in the future, including biological and health sciences, physical sciences and engineering, language and liberal arts, and business and management.
Details of the exchange are still being developed.
